We just left Aulani after a 13 night stay. The housekeeping staff and supervisors are the worst we have experienced in our full time living in our timeshares for the last 20 months. The worst out of 50+ reservations!!
We checked in Feb 1st and checked out Feb 14th.
Housekeeping schedule:
Feb 4th full cleaning
Feb 8th thrash/tidy
Feb 13th full cleaning
With approval of housekeeping supervisor the full cleaning on the 13th was moved to the 12th.
Feb 4th - full cleaning good job!
Feb 8th - no trash and tidy. Called housekeeping at 4:30 and they said they forgot us and would send someone right up. They changed out the towels and emptied the trash and that's it. No amenities were replaced and there was less than 1/8 of a roll of toilet tissue. Went to the front desk and got supplies.
Feb 9th nothing scheduled but got trash and tidy - here again not everything was done
Feb 11th - trash and tidy, about half the amenities were replaced.
Feb 12th time for full cleaning - maid refused to accomplish full cleaning, said that her schedule showed trash and tidy only.
Feb 13 - maid came and refused to do full cleaning "since you are leaving tomorrow, no need to clean your room." Asked if we needed any supplies refilled but twice refused to do the full cleaning.
Spoke with front desk supervisor who said all the right things but really didn't care.
I'm sending a complaint in to DVC and ask for a $50 credit towards my maintenance fees due to the Aulani housekeeping staff refusing to do the full cleaning but I paid MX fees for the cleaning.
I love everything else about Aulani but I am getting really tired of DVC cheating members out of housekeeping that we have paid for in our MX dues.
This was our 4th stay at Aulani and the same thing happened on 3 out of the 4 stays. It seems like Aulani housekeeping can not comprehend someone staying longer than a one week stay.
We own a total of 9 different timeshares including DVC. We have more trouble with DVC then all the others combined!
